正文
python3字典一键多值,python字典中一键多值的写入
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
python如何遍历多键值的字典并使用对应键的值来替换?
说明:python中怎么改变一个字典的对应键的值很简单,直接赋值即可。
在python文件中输入di[day]=25,并且通过print(di) 输出字典,在输出结果中可以看到键‘day’对应的值变为25了。 注:在字典中键是唯一的,值是可变的,并且可以取任何数据类型。
print(字典的键值对:, i)print(字典的键:, i[0])print(字典的值:, i[1])总结 1,列表的遍历比较简单,除了配合enumerate()使用,可以同步获取索引以外,并没有特别值得纠结的。
字典是一种通过名字或者关键字引用的得数据结构,其键可以是数字、字符串、元组,这种结构类型也称之为映射。
:数据为键(key)值(value)对形式,每个键值对之间用逗号隔开如:dict1={name:小明,age:18,gender:男} 字典的操作:dict1[name]=小红dict1[id]=3 如果key存在,将修改其所对应的值。
dic.keys(): dic[key] = valprint(输入完成。
python字典的键和值
在 Python 中,字典(Dictionary)是一种无序的数据结构,用于存储键-值对(Key-Value Pairs)。字典元素由键(Key)和对应的值(Value)两部分组成。
dict.clear()clear() 用于清空字典中所有元素(键-值对),对一个字典执行 clear() 方法之后,该字典就会变成一个空字典。dict.copy()copy() 用于返回一个字典的浅拷贝。
在Python中,可以使用字典的键来获取相应的值,并进行计算。
字典的key值是不可以重复的,如果重复默认取最后一个value值。如果做 print dict_data 结果是:{b:2, a:ddd}。key不能重复,但是字典的value值可以是任意类型。
python123根据键盘输入输出字典的值# 以输入3个值和键为:dic = {}for i in range(0,3):key = input(输入建:)val = input(输入值:)。
一共三个,分别取所有的键(keys()),值(values())和键值对(items())。返回的类似于列表,但不是列表。其类型分别为dict_keys,dict_values和dict_items。
python字典中的值为什么不允许重复
d = {key1 : 1, key2 : hi, key3:[]}在字典中,键的内容是不可重复的。 键为不可变数据类型,值可以是任何数据类型。在这里,键只支持 字符串类型。
字典的key值是不可以重复的,如果重复默认取最后一个value值。如果做 print dict_data 结果是:{b:2, a:ddd}。key不能重复,但是字典的value值可以是任意类型。
回到字典key问题,python的dict的key必须是唯一的,所以,其必须是一个可哈希的值,才能保证得到唯一的内存地址。在python里,字符串,数字,元组都是不可变对象,也是可哈希的值。
字典的“键”和集合的元素都是唯一的,不允许重复。
这里面有两个影响因素:(1)键值的哈希碰撞,hash(key1)==hash(key2)时,向字典里连续添加的这个两个键的顺序是不可以控制的,也是无法做到连续的,后来的键会按算法调整到其它位置。
不重复!!集合定义:集合set,是一个无序的不重复元素序列。创建:可以使用大括号{}或者set()函数创建集合。注意:创建一个空集合必须用set()而不是{},因为{}是用来创建一个空字典。
python如何用字典统计列表中不同元素个数
方法一:使用count()方法点击学习大厂名师精品课count()方法是Python中最简单的一种统计方法。它可以统计列表、元组和字符串中一个元素或一个单词出现的次数。
这里用到了字典基本的建立,value调用,键值对增加,value修改,以及items()函数。
第一种是新建一个dict,键是列表中的元素,值是统计的个数,然后遍历list。
打开python语言命令窗口,定义一个列表变量Z并打印对应的列表值。调用列表中的方法max(),可以获取列表中所有元素中最大值。使用第二步中对应的方法min(),可以获取列表中最小值。
python字典的基本操作
1、新建一个字典,host是键,earth是值。
2、字典的操作:dict1[name]=小红dict1[id]=3 如果key存在,将修改其所对应的值。
3、缓存数据:字典可以用来缓存一些计算结果或中间数据,以便后续的计算或操作。例如,我们可以将一些常用的数据或计算结果存储在字典中,以避免重复计算和提高程序的运行效率。
4、如果用dict实现,只需要一个“名字”-“成绩”的对照表,直接根据名字查找成绩,无论这个表有多大,查找速度都不会变慢。
5、创建字典字典由键和对应值成对组成。字典也被称作关联数组或哈希表。
python3字典一键多值的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于python字典中一键多值的写入、python3字典一键多值的信息别忘了在本站进行查找喔。